Stringer's Ridge Tunnel Closed Wednesday Evening

  • Wednesday, December 17, 2014

TDOT Operations crews will be closing the Stringer’s Ridge Tunnel on Wednesday from 8 p.m.-6 a.m. to perform maintenance and repair work on the overhead drainage system.

The overhead drainage system is leaking, which is allowing water to fall onto the roadway below.  Last year there were problems with ice formation in the tunnel during cold weather because of these leaks, and the repairs should improve that situation.  

The crews hope to complete the work in one night, but if they don’t complete the work, they will also be working on Thursday between 8 p.m.-6 a.m. 

Detours will be posted during the tunnel closure.
